PANGANIBAN, J.:
 
Factual findings of trial courts which are affirmed by the Court of Appeals are, as a general rule, binding and conclusive upon the Supreme Court. Alibi, on the other hand, cannot prevail over positive identification by credible witnesses. Furthermore, alleged violations of constitutional rights during custodial investigation are relevant only when the conviction of the accused by the trial court is based on the evidence obtained during such investigation.
